How much did Albanians travel during 2025? Movements abroad recorded an increase of 14.3%
During 2025, Albanian residents over the age of 15 made about 4.5 million trips within and outside the country, for personal or business purposes. The data shows that the vast majority of these movements are related to leisure, holidays and family visits, while business trips remain at a lower weight.
According to statistics, 97.6% of trips were made for personal reasons, while only 2.4% for business purposes. The summer months continue to be the most active periods for travel, with the peak in August, which accounts for 12.6% of the total, followed by June with 10.9% and July with 9.8%. An increase in movements was also recorded in December, with 10.2%, mainly related to the holiday period.
Within the territory of Albania, around 4.4 million personal trips were made, with the main motive being "vacation and leisure", accounting for 52.8% of the total. Meanwhile, for trips abroad, the main reason was visiting relatives and friends, with 52% of cases.
Movements outside Albania have marked a significant increase in 2025, increasing by 14.3% compared to 2024. In parallel with this trend, Albanians have used more accommodation structures such as hotels and rental facilities (Airbnb, etc.), which increased by 5.6% and 5.9% respectively.
Among the most notable developments was the increase in the use of air transport, which recorded the highest growth of around 14%, reflecting a greater trend for faster travel and destinations abroad. These figures show a year of more mobility and a strong return of travel as part of the Albanian lifestyle.
